![]() "Anything goes" set to hit the stage at STH this weekend web posted November 6, 2006 The cast has been working on the show since school began, and some even met during this past summer to begin work. McKinney feels the terrific cast has put in much effort to bring the 1930’s show to life, while adding an exciting twist – the show will transform into a modern day production. McKinney is especially excited about a new, creative beginning that is sure to please the audience! The set is another beautiful design from stage manager and assistant director, Lynn Rearden, and was built by Stephen Cantrell, Charles Reames, and Mitchell Herring. The stage is sure to bring “oohs” and “aahs” as the curtain opens. Another surprise is that Tracie Luquire-Watson is not only choreographing the show, but is starring in the lead role that she played fourteen years ago after graduating. Joining the show are other adults who help make the show possible, Carole Chidley plays the flute; Vicky Clark, as assistant stage manager, with Marcie Watson, Janet Reames, Ruthann McCann, and Mrs. Wheeler helping backstage and with make-up. McKinney and his staff would also like to say many thanks to the gracious patrons that support the program! This show is a treat and will bring smiles to all.
